6-80-105. Student financial aid -- Scholarship stacking.

(a) As used in this section:

(1) "Cost of attendance" means the recognized cost of attendance of an institution of higher education calculated under rules established by the Department of Higher Education;

(2) "Federal aid" means scholarships or grants awarded to a student as a result of the Free Application for Federal Student Aid, excluding the Pell grant;

(3) "Other aid" means scholarships, grants, tuition waivers, or housing waivers awarded to a student from postsecondary institutions or private sources;

(4) "State aid" means scholarships or grants awarded to a student from public funds, including without limitation the Arkansas Academic Challenge Scholarship under 6-85-201 et seq., the Department of Higher Education scholarship and grant programs, state general revenues, tuition, and local tax revenue; and

(5) "Student aid package" means federal aid, state aid, and other aid a student receives for postsecondary education expenses.

(b) (1) A postsecondary institution shall not award state aid in a student aid package in excess of the cost of attendance at the institution where the student enrolls.

(2) For the purpose of stacking scholarships in a student's student aid package, the Arkansas Academic Challenge Scholarship under 6-85-201 et seq. shall be reduced or returned first.

(c) A postsecondary institution shall report to the department the total amount of federal aid, state aid, and other aid a student receives if the student receives an award from a department scholarship or grant program, including the Arkansas Academic Challenge Scholarship under 6-85-201 et seq.

(d) (1) When a student receives a student aid package that includes state aid and the student aid package exceeds the cost of attendance, the postsecondary institution shall repay state aid in the amount exceeding the cost of attendance, starting with state aid received under the Arkansas Academic Challenge Scholarship under 6-85-201 et seq.

(2) The department shall credit the excess state aid funds to the appropriate department fund or trust account.
